Ingredients

Ingredients

  • 4 large eggs 1 cup matzo meal 1/4 cup seltzer 1/4 cup schmaltz (reserved from broth), melted 2 teaspoons finely grated fresh ginger 1/2 teaspoon celery seed, optional 1/4 cup finely chopped fresh dill or flat-leaf parsley (or a combination), plus more for serving Kosher salt and freshly ground pepper Enriched Chicken Broth 3 medium carrots, peeled and cut into 1/4-inch rounds

Directions

Beat eggs in a large bowl. Stir in matzo meal, seltzer, schmaltz, ginger, celery seed, herbs, 1 teaspoon salt, and 1/4 teaspoon pepper. Stir until combined (mixture will be loose).

Cover and refrigerate until mixture stiffens slightly, at least 30 minutes and up to 1 day. Place 2 cups broth in a wide pot. Add water to fill pot to 2 1/2 inches. Bring to a boil; season with 1 tablespoon salt. With dampened hands (to prevent sticking), divide chilled matzo mixture into 6 equal portions. Form each into a sphere.

Gently place balls in pot, one at a time. Cover and reduce heat to low to maintain a simmer (do not let boil). Cook, turning them a few times, until puffed and cooked through to center, 1 hour to 1 hour, 15 minutes.

Meanwhile, bring remaining 10 cups broth and carrots to a boil in a separate pot. Reduce heat to medium-low; simmer until carrots are tender, 12 to 15 minutes. Season with salt. Transfer matzo balls to serving bowls. Divide broth and carrots evenly among them; top with more herbs. Serve immediately.
